Half German, quarter Swedish, second-quarter Norwegian, Madchen Emik was born in Reno, Nevada. When she was two and a half years old, her parents divorced, her mother remarried, and it is the influence of her stepfather Madchen owes her acting career.
With her parental blessing, Madchen dropped out of school at 16 and went to Los Angeles to conquer Hollywood. It wasn’t as easy as she dreamed, so Madchen became a model and then worked as a dancer in various music videos.
In 1988, she starred in an episode of Star Trek, in which she played a werewolf - she even had to turn into a teddy bear. A year later, she appeared in an episode of Malibu Rescue. A year later, David Lynch chose her character Shelley in his famous TV series Twin Peaks.
In 1994, together with James Spader, she played in the thriller Dream Lover, after which she returned to television, although from time to time she pleases fans with some next thriller.
Madchen lives happily with her husband, musician David Alexis and two children, loves to talk about all mysticism in his life and still works for TV.
